Clinical efficacy of psychotherapy inclusive of Buddhist psychology in female psychosomatic medicine
著者 Ushiroyama, T.

抄録Human beings have been asking themselves about the meaning of life and the significance of human life since ancient times. Medical care in cooperation with religion can save human's mind and body. Being burdened with a lot of social/cultural problems in the modern Japanese society, climacteric women who consult a doctor for symptoms of indefinite complaint have been increasing. One of the teachings of Siddhartha Gautama is "Seeing things as they really are" ("Nyojitsu-chiken" in Japanese). This means that seeing the reality as it is and is the way of thinking that "it is important to embrace the reality and live positively, instead of trying to do everything as one wants to and turning a blind eye to the reality." Psychotherapy inclusive Buddhist psychology was performed in 16 climacteric women with undefined symptoms. Visual analog scale for subjective symptoms decreased significantly after 2-6 months of treatment (25.7+/-10.2) from the baseline value (72.4+/-12.8) (p <0.0001). After psychotherapy, no change was observed in plasma cortisol concentration; however, salivary chromogranin A concentration significantly decreased (− 61%). Practice of Buddhism is the same as psychotherapy in which suffering people become aware of 'self,' find a way of self-fulfillment, and release their minds from suffering. The practice of integrated psychotherapy of acceptance and sympathy, support, and assurance into "Not same individuality, but same human", "Seeing things as they really are", and "There is no such things as permanence" as Buddhist psychology is highly expected in the female psychosomatic medicine.
